I want to use my fn keys as normal fn keys within my code editor (WebStorm). I tried Fluor but it doesn't work unless "Use all F1, F2, etc. keys as standard function keys" is checked within Karabiner Elements.

Any ideas about how I might use both tools without conflicts? What about possibly integrating a similar functionality within Karabiner?

Found out how to use Preferences > Complex Modifications to achieve this.

  • You can import "Function keys work as fn keys (instead of media keys)" from Karabiner-Elements complex_modifications rules
  • Edit the script in ~/.config/karabiner/assets/complex_modifications to apply to your applications
  • Add rule under Preferences > Complex Modifications
